Web12 jan. 2016 · To find out the correct user name type net user in the command line window and hit Enter. 2. Sign out or reboot your PC: 3. Log in to another account: 4. Go to the Users folder (C:\Users by default) and rename the profile folder to whatever you like: 5. Launch the registry editor: Navigate to: Web16 aug. 2024 · 3 Open Windows Terminal, and select either Windows PowerShell or Command Prompt. Make note of the SID (ex: "S-1-5-21-2212846312-626644311-134141314-1002") for the account (ex: "Brink2") you want to change the name of its user profile folder. You will need to know this SID in step 6 below. 5 Open Registry Editor …

Web11 dec. 2024 · Log in using another administrative account (create one if required) Go to the C:\Users\ folder and rename the sub-folder C SINGHA to C SINHA Start regedit and navigate to the key H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\SOFTWARE\Microsoft\Windows NT\CurrentVersion\ProfileList\ Modify the registry value ProfileImagePath to …
